- Backseat Organizers Keep chaos at bay with a well-designed backseat organizer. These keep snacks, drinks, tablets, and toys within easy reach of kids, preventing constant requests from the front. Organizers priced around $20-50 were effective. Car Accessories For Road Trip With Kids (2026 Complete Guide)
- Portable DVD Players For longer stretches, a portable DVD player offers dedicated entertainment without draining your phone battery. Options in the $100-200 price range provide hours of distraction. Car Accessories For Road Trip With Kids (2026 Complete Guide), 15 Car Accessories to Make Traveling with Kids a Breeze
- Car Seat Covers Spills and messes are inevitable with kids. A durable car seat cover, typically costing $30-60, makes cleanup easier, protecting upholstery and keeping the cabin fresh. Car Accessories For Road Trip With Kids (2026 Complete Guide)
- Window Shades Simple, effective window shades block harsh rays and maintain a cooler cabin, essential for little ones. We found these a crucial addition for any family road trip. 15 Car Accessories to Make Traveling with Kids a Breeze
- Travel Tray Tables Attaching to front seatbacks, these provide a stable surface for coloring, snacks, or playing, keeping kids engaged and minimizing messes. 15 Car Accessories to Make Traveling with Kids a Breeze

Budget vs Premium Options
Here's a breakdown of budget versus premium car accessories for a road trip with kids:
Budget options get you the essentials for a functional trip. You'll find backseat organizers for a reasonable price, typically ranging from $20-$50 Car Accessories For Road Trip With Kids (2026 Complete Guide). These keep snacks, toys, and drinks within reach, preventing a chaotic cabin. A portable DVD player can be found in the $100-$200 range Car Accessories For Road Trip With Kids (2026 Complete Guide), offering crucial entertainment for long stretches. Sunshades for windows and basic travel pillows also fall into this category, providing comfort and blocking glare.
Premium options offer enhanced durability, convenience, and specialized features. While specific price points vary, expect to pay more for high-end versions of organizers, often made with more robust materials and additional compartments. Similarly, premium entertainment systems or tablets might cost significantly more than basic portable DVD players. These upgrades focus on maximizing comfort, minimizing stress, and providing a more enjoyable experience for both kids and parents.
What you get with budget is basic functionality and essential organization. You sacrifice advanced features, superior materials, and often, long-term durability. Premium offers greater comfort, extended entertainment options, and premium build quality, but at a higher cost. The best choice depends on your budget and how frequently you plan to use these accessories. For occasional trips, budget options are perfectly adequate. For frequent travelers or those seeking maximum convenience, the premium investment can be worthwhile.
